“Climb the Mountain”

In "Climb the Mountain," the Justice League faces a desperate stand as Parasite unleashes chaos across Metropolis, leaving Superman's absence felt more than ever. With Black Lightning, Steel, and the rest of the team holding the line, the pressure mounts in a story that tests their resolve and unity. Written by Adam Beechen and illustrated by Carlo Barberi, with inks by Bob Petrecca and colors by Heroic Age, the issue's dynamic art is matched by Ty Templeton’s intense cover.
